Preparing for Operation: A Checklist for Success
Before commencing operation, it’s crucial to conduct a thorough check of the equipment and the environment to ensure a safe working condition. This includes:
- Personal Protection: Operators must wear personal protective equipment (PPE), such as safety helmets, protective glasses, earplugs, gloves, and safety shoes, to prevent injuries from flying debris, metal chips, or equipment failure.
- Equipment Inspection: Conduct a visual inspection of the saw, paying attention to the power line, switch, and buttons. Verify that the earth is reliable, and the saw belt is properly tensioned, worn, and correctly directed.
- Part Preparation: Confirm that the material, size, and weight of the part comply with the equipment’s treatment range and select the suitable saw belt and cutting settings. Ensure the part is securely fastened to prevent relaxation or falling during processing.
During Operation: Best Practices for Safe and Efficient Production
- Concentration: Operators muststay focused and avoid distractions throughout the operation.
- Standardized Operation: Adhere to the equipment’s operating procedures, and refrain from altering programs or parameters without authorization.
- Feeding Material: Feed materials stably and evenly to prevent abrupt movements or excessive force, which can compromise the saw’s performance and safety.
- Proper Work Positioning: Maintain a safe position while operating, keeping a safe distance from the saw belt and mobile parts to prevent injuries.
- Emergency Protocol: In the event of an abnormal situation, such as unusual noise, vibrations, or smoke, immediately press the emergency stop button, switch off the power, and alert the relevant personnel for assistance.
Post-Operation: Maintenance and Housekeeping for Optimal Performance
- Equipment Turn-Off: When finished, ensure the saw belt is powered down before turning off the main power.
- Cleanliness: Thoroughly clean the equipment and work areas, storing parts, tools, and other items to maintain a tidy environment.
- Maintenance: Regularly maintain the equipment, including cleaning, lubricating, tightening, and adjusting, to guarantee optimal performance and prevent mechanical issues.
Additional Precautions for Secure Operation
- Certified Operators: Ensure that operators have received vocational training, familiarized themselves with the equipment’s structure, performance, operational procedures, and safety precautions, and obtained relevant operating certificates before commencing work.
- No Unauthorized Operations: Prohibit the use of equipment under overload, unauthorized saw belts, or unskilled accessories, and refrain from repairing or adjusting the equipment during operation.
- Emergency Preparedness: Familiarize yourself with the emergency equipment safety plan, conduct regular drills, and enhance emergency response capabilities to minimize the risk of accidents and ensure a safe working environment.
